Output 866f48b4a15a975da8dd95c3364115357b4c73c1f0d665e58232ea7aa5fb9811:26

value
143495680
script pubkey
OP_0 OP_PUSHBYTES_32 508c53f81a5e1e484bad239e4699c41e9db64492e5834b2751533d3cc2a571bd
address
bc1q2zx987q6tc0ysjadyw0ydxwyr6wmv3yjukp5kf632v7nes49wx7s093t5q
transaction
866f48b4a15a975da8dd95c3364115357b4c73c1f0d665e58232ea7aa5fb9811
spent
true